Honey vs. Sugar: What’s Better?

What do you reach for when you’re brewing a cup of tea? Honey or sugar? Though both offer sweetness, the choice is tough, especially considering the nutritional benefits you can gain. There’s been an ongoing debate on which is better, sugar or honey. If you’re still confused, let’s clear it out.


Benefits of Honey

It’s no secret that honey is loaded with benefits, especially when taken naturally. Unlike sugar, honey can be used in small amounts without compromising sweetness. This is because honey has higher levels of fructose than glucose, and fructose is sweeter. Still, that’s not the best part about this ingredient! Natural honey is rich in vitamins, nutrients, and minerals, making it a highly healthy and natural ingredient.

Some benefits of honey consumption can include a strong immune system, remedy for cough and flu, improved cardiovascular health, effective blood sugar management, and more. Honey can also help fight illnesses due to its antifungal and antibacterial properties. Plus, when used on wounds or burns can help in rapid healing. In addition, raw honey contains pollen which can help ease allergic reactions.

Downsides of Honey

Frankly, there aren’t many downsides to honey since honey is an organic ingredient that doesn’t go through extensive processing as sugar does. However, there are a few cons of honey, such as high calories count.

A teaspoon of honey contains nearly 22 calories which means people need to be careful when consuming honey, especially if they’re struggling with health concerns such as obesity.

However, when used with different ingredients, honey can help in weight loss too. Moreover, honey can be harmful to babies younger than 12 months.

Benefits of Sugar

sugar cubes

Sugar has the potential to provide quick energy since it’s a carbohydrate. Your brain requires 130 grams of glucose every day to function properly. Sugar is a low source of calories providing only about 16 calories per teaspoon. Another advantage is sugar is easily available and inexpensive.

Cons of Sugar

Unfortunately, sugar has its fair share of risks. Consuming too much sugar can increase the risks of diabetes and cardiovascular diseases. The worst part is most processed foods contain high amounts of sugar, and we consume them regularly without realizing it.

As a result, sugar increases health risks and can be a leading cause of obesity and weight gain. In addition, diabetes patients need to be careful of their sugar consumption since it can immediately increase blood sugar. When consumed in high amounts, you can get a sugar rush followed by an immediate energy drop.
